LGU OF PURA COMMEMORATES WORLD AIDS DAY THROUGH A COLOR FUN RUN AND THE LIGHTING OF CANDLES
The LGU of Pura, headed by Mayor Freddie D. Domingo, observed World AIDS Day through various activities on December 2. 2022. In partnership with different NGAs, the RHU of Pura, led by Dr. Liberty Domingo, spearheaded the commemoration of World AIDS Day.
Mr. Brian Von Dayrit provided a lecture regarding HIV, which aims to raise awareness about the importance of engaging youth in the prevention and treatment of HIV/AIDS.
In addition, highlights of the said observance were the Color Fun Run and Zumba, which were participated by LGU employees, NGOs and CSOs, students from different schools in Pura, and fellow Puranians. The purpose of the Color Fun Run is to bring people together and to raise awareness about HIV-AIDS to curb the increasing number of cases in the locality.
The lighting of candles concluded the said commemoration, which served as a tribute and prayer to all victims.
World AIDS Day remains as relevant today as it is always been, reminding people and governments that HIV has not gone away. There is still a critical need for increased funding for the AIDS response to raise awareness of the impact of HIV on people’s lives, to end stigma and discrimination, and to improve the quality of life of people living with HIV.
